Offer description

An opportunity has arisen for a Quantity Surveyor to join a growing Scottish building contractor. This national contractor are involved in a variety of work from short 1-2 day turnaround projects to major lump sum infrastructure works.
You will play a crucial role in managing all aspects of the cost management process for designated projects. Key responsibilities include cost management, procurement, valuation of variations, contract administration, financial reporting, risk management, and compliance.

On offer is a strong salary accompanied by an extensive benefits package that includes generous pension contributions, private healthcare, company car / allowance and bonus. You will be involved with innovative projects, working within a collaborative culture that offers professional growth, and continuous training and development opportunities.
Significant experience in a contracting QS role is essential
Mid-level QS and Senior QS will be considered
NEC 3 or JCT contract experience preferred but not essential
Degree qualified in Quantity Surveying or equivalent
